Action item (owner: platform auth team, reviewer requested): harden the session-token refresh path in Mirell after incident 2024-11. Concurrent refreshes could mint tokens with stale scopes. Fix adds a per-session mutex and scope revalidation; security review should confirm the mutex cannot be bypassed via the legacy mobile endpoint. The threat model and diff summary are posted here.

operations page: https://confluence.qorvellabs.internal/pages/projects/projects/projects

- [ ] Key ceremony, step 7 (plugin authors, heads up!): once the revamped password-reset flow on Fernhollow goes live, your plugins must request the new reset-token scope. During the ceremony we'll rotate the signing key and re-seal the escrow box — don't publish updates until we confirm. When the escrow box asks for it, type the recovery passphrase shown below.

strongbox words: aldax-istox-sorion-isteth-gilion-tamius-norok-aldax-fraox-wenius

Subject: Inventory write-down — Q4

Executive team,

For the board: we will write down 1.8m of Tollivant-series stock this quarter. Cause: obsolescence following the Merrow line launch. Auditors at Hartfell & Gray concur. Cash impact nil; margin impact one-off. Disposal via the Calderby outlet channel. The confidential plan this supports is set out below.

internal memo for kawip-hadug: Headcount on the Wenwyn team goes from 7 to 140 by the end of January. Gross margin on Wenwyn came in at 20 percent against a plan of 15 percent.

Title: Seatwise pricing experiment showing wrong tier to some buyers

Summary: The Seatwise A/B pricing experiment occasionally serves the variant price at checkout but the control price on the confirmation page. Customers may report mismatched totals; refund the difference per standard policy. Fix is deployed and the experiment is paused pending re-verification. Affected sessions can be matched using the trace below.

trace token, kahog-tajeg: htk6_97d963